#1 2018-05-14 09:15:55

greybeard
Trusted Member
Registered: 2015-01-09
Posts: 11

HAProxy script error debian 9 at GestionDBI les vps

This error has been reported previously for debian 8 in this thread https://forum.lowendspirit.com/viewtopic.php?id=3424




Believe the error is present with debian 9 as well.

./NATreverseProxy.sh proxy list
curl: (6) Could not resolve host: .5

As far as I can debug the error is in the awk statement that extracts the venet ip using ifconfig. It returns an empty string with the tralling constant '.5' which doesn't resolve.

near the start of proxy.sh

# Setting of basic variables
# HOSTNODE_ADDRESS=localhost:8000
HOSTNODE_ADDRESS="$(ifconfig venet0:0 | awk -F: '/inet addr:/ { split($2,a,"."); print a[1]"."a[2]"."a[3]; }').5"

for reference o/p of ifconfig venet0:0 (IP redacted)

ifconfig venet0:0
venet0:0: flags=211<UP,BROADCAST,POINTOPOINT,RUNNING,NOARP>  mtu 1500
        inet xxx.xx.xx.xx  netmask 255.255.255.255  broadcast xxx.xx.xx.xx  destination xx.xx.xx.xx
        unspec 00-00-00-00-00-00-00-00-00-00-00-00-00-00-00-00  txqueuelen 0  (UNSPEC)

Offline

Board footer

Powered by FluxBB